Descrizione | . Scegliere tra diversi tipi di architetture di basi dati (quali relazionale, gerarchico, a matrice, orientato agli oggetti) quella adatta ai requisiti dell’applicazione
. Utilizzare SQL per istruzioni ‘select’ di base, ridurre e riordinare i dati, trasformare i dati attraverso funzioni di una sola riga, visualizzare i dati contenuti in diverse tabelle e viste, aggregare i dati utilizzando funzioni di raggruppamento, estrarre risultati complessi attraverso sottoquery, manipolazione di dati (comandi DML)
. Produrre output leggibili attraverso SQL interattivo
. Estrarre dati in formato XML
. Gestire la manipolazione di dati utilizzando stored procedure, transazioni, trigger, funzioni definite dall’utente e viste
. Definire la sicurezza a livello oggetti, inclusi i permessi a livello di colonna, utilizzando GRANT, REVOKE e DENY
. Sapere come utilizzare le interfacce standard di database, quali ODBC, JDBC
. Modificare gli oggetti di un database in modo che supportino la replicazione e le viste partizionate
. Individua e risolve malfunzionamenti di creazione fallita di un oggetto
|